RANGE— The Showdown Troller is equipped with 5-separate depth ranges—
20,40,60,80,and120’.Regardlessofthemanualdepthrangesetting,
Showdown Troller will always display digital depth down to 120’, even if bottom
is deeper than the bottom limit of your current RANGE setting.
AUTO RANGE—In Auto Range mode, Showdown Troller will automatically
lock into the depth range appropriate to the depth of the water. For instance,
in 32-feet of water, Showdown Troller will automatically lock in at the 40-foot
depth range. Auto Range allows you to simply turn on the power and begin
fishing. Your Ice Troller is in Auto Range Mode when you turn it on.

METRIC— To change your display to read in meters rather than feet, press and
holdtheRANGE/METRICforapproximately4seconds.Wheninmetricmode,
all depth measurements, including zoom functions, will be displayed in meters.
Repeat this process to return to measurements in feet.

BATTERY STATUS—PressandholdtheNOISE/BATTbuttonforapproximately
4 seconds and your battery status will appear, reflected in a percentage of
0-100 at the bottom of the display. This status indicator will disappear after a
few seconds.
